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Blotched stingaree | Chibchan water mouse |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Elasmobranchii |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Myliobatiformes (Myliobatiformes) | Rodentia (Rodents) |
| Family | Urolophidae | Cricetidae |
| Genus | Urolophus | Chibchanomys |
| Species | Urolophus mitosis | Chibchanomys trichotis |
Evolutionary Relationship
Blotched stingaree and Chibchan water mouse share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
